Abstract
The present invention provides a kind of multipurpose buckle structure, including plug division, socket, connector portions and line buckling structure, and plug division is rotatably connected by switching part with socket, and connector portions one end is connected with socket, and its other end is connected with line buckling structure;By using above technical scheme, by increasing capacitance it is possible to increase the purposes of this buckle structure, compact conformation, simple, cost are relatively low, and can farthest use the performance of the structure;Simpler effective during installation and retaining element, reduction is artificial into installation cost.

Embodiment
It should be noted that in the case where not conflicting, the feature in embodiment and embodiment in the application can phase
Mutually combination.Describe the present invention in detail below with reference to the accompanying drawings and in conjunction with the embodiments.
As shown in Figure 1 to Figure 3, the present invention provides a kind of multipurpose buckle structure, including plug division 1, socket 2, connector portions
3 and line buckling structure;Wherein plug division 1 is rotatably connected by switching part 8 with socket 2, can so cause this multipurpose to insert
The plug division 1 of buckle structure again with after interface grafting, socket 2 can be rotated with line buckling structure, it is to avoid bundle or install part
When axial rotation damage buckle structure;The one end of connector portions 3 is connected with socket 2, and its other end is connected with line buckling structure;The present embodiment
In, plug division 1, socket 2 and connector portions 3 are that plastics or rubber are made, so that buckle structure has elastic buffer, no
It is easily damaged, and easily installs;Further, connected between plug division 1 and socket by switching part 8, be so conducive to inserting
Socket part 1 with that can be buffered in interface connection procedure, and plug division 1 be plugged in after interface can by switching part 8 with insert
Step progress is spacing between socket part 1, effectively improves the fastening effect of this buckle structure;Specifically, switching part 8 from plug division 1 to
The length of socket 2 is 1cm to 3cm, so that fastening effect is optimal after grafting, and rotating effect is more preferable.
Preferably, with reference to such scheme, as shown in Figure 1 to Figure 3, in this implementation, plug division 1 is triangular pyramid;And three
Card-tight part 11 is additionally provided with the conical surface of pyramid;Card-tight part 11 is elastic triangular plate, and elastic triangular plate one end is fixed on by step
On the conical surface, its other end freely extends along the conical surface, when the insertion interface of plug division 1 is cavity to be provided with interface, so that elastic
Triangular plate can block as in cavity, can so play a part of fastening card-tight part.
Preferably, with reference to such scheme, in the present embodiment, plug division can also be polygon prism shape or multi-prism taper, as long as
It can want to match and can achieve the goal with interface;And the cylinder of prism-shaped is provided with card-tight part, so can equally play card
Tight effect;Similarly, the conical surface is provided with card-tight part.
Preferably, with reference to such scheme, as shown in Figure 1 to Figure 3, in this implementation, the one of switching part 8 and plug division 1 into
Type, can so play and facilitate plug division 1 to rotate and not easily shifted effect, and the life-span is longer;Further, one end of switching part 1
Provided with rotating part 10;Socket 2 contacts side with rotating part 10 provided with through hole;Rotating part 10 causes plug division 1 with inserting through through hole
Seat 2 is rotatably connected.
Preferably, with reference to such scheme, as shown in Figure 1 to Figure 3, in this implementation, socket 1 is connected side with rotating part 8 and set
There is layer of silica gel 9;Layer of silica gel 9 mainly prevents the socket during grafting of plug division 1 from directly acting in plug division 1 to be easily damaged rotation
Transfer part 8.
Preferably, with reference to such scheme, as shown in Figure 1 to Figure 3, line buckling structure also includes cingulum in the present embodiment;Cingulum
Including the first cingulum 4 and the second cingulum 5;The two ends of connector portions 3 are respectively equipped with jack;It is equipped with first cingulum 4 and the second cingulum 5
Buckle 6;The jack phase clamping of the buckle 6 on the cingulum 4 of buckle 6 and second respectively with the two ends of connector portions 3 on first cingulum 4, leads to
Crossing can farthest be utilized this buckle structure using such scheme, and the cingulum that especially can be by both sides is carried out tightly
Gu, binding road etc., it is more convenient.
Preferably, with reference to such scheme, as shown in Figure 1 to Figure 3, the present embodiment center tap portion 3 is connected one end with socket 2
Provided with through hole;Socket 2 is provided with rotation section 12, and rotation section 12 is integrally formed with socket 2;Rotation section 12 makes socket 2 through through hole
It is rotatably connected with connector portions 3;Using such scheme so that this buckle structure can be with Double-directional rotary, so after tightening more
It is convenient free, it is not easy to damage buckle structure.
